Deputy Commander of the Estonian Defence Forces, Brigadier General Viktor Kalnitksy together with Ambassador Annely Kolk met with Deputy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, Brigadier General Andrii Lebedenko.ї

The parties noted the importance of Estonia’s participation in the Priority Ukraine Requirements List (PURL) initiative a particularly in financing the delivery of critically important U.S.-made weapons to Ukraine.
The Ukrainian side expressed gratitude to Estonia for its contribution to the Electronic Warfare Coalition and the Maritime Capabilities Coalition, which are focused on developing the capabilities of the Defence Forces of Ukraine and training Ukrainian military personnel.

The parties discussed the current security situation. The Deputy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ces of Ukraine briefed Deputy Commander of the Estonian Defence Forces on the situation along the frontline and the immediate requirements of the Armed Forces of Ukraine. In particular, the parties discussed technological aspects related to medical support.
